About this role

Work Location : Los Angeles, CA; Onsite Work Schedule : Monday to Friday, 8 hours per day Engagement Model : Fixed-term employment; Full-time Estimated Project Duration : 2 months Estimated Start Date : August 24th, 2026 Language(s) Needed : English (US) Role Summary The Moderator will work onsite to ensure the proper execution of study/project requirements. The primary responsibility is to participate in video sessions and provide updates to the other members of the production team, as well as performing very basic troubleshooting of data collection technology. Role Responsibilities Participate in and support required video-recorded scenarios and study activities Operate and maintain data collection equipment, offload data, manage logistics, provide daily reports, and lead the overall high-quality data generation for this effort, day in, day out Understand provided project documentation Capture data for the assigned project, aiming to reach the targeted daily goal Utilize client tools to label/tag data Convey sessions details to the Project Manager and Production team Communicate and coordinate with project team Interact with various hardware & software Assist in preparing session materials and setting up facility Provide feedback on session dynamics and participant engagement Ability to lift up 50lbs when needed Role Requirements Comfortable being on camera for a most of the day Experience in moderation, facilitation, proctoring or similar roles preferred Possess basic technical knowledge and experience in using iOS Experience using a lux light meter to measure and assess lighting conditions is required. Must have access to a reliable personal vehicle, as regular travel is required for this role Strong interpersonal and communication skills Ability to manage groups and foster a positive environment Detail-oriented with a knack for problem-solving Ability to work flexibly and adapt to changing scenarios High attention to detail Integrity and strong work ethic Team
